- What is Freedom Holding's other — net gain on foreign exchange operations?
- Freedom Holding (FRHC) reported other — net gain on foreign exchange operations of $1.48M in Q4 2025.
- How has Freedom Holding's other — net gain on foreign exchange operations changed year-over-year?
- Freedom Holding's other — net gain on foreign exchange operations decreased by 92.2% year-over-year, from $18.89M to $1.48M.

- What does other — net gain on foreign exchange operations mean?
- Represents the net profit or loss resulting from foreign currency exchange activities conducted within the 'Other' segment. This captures gains or losses from fluctuations in currency values during trading or settlement of foreign-denominated assets and liabilities. It highlights the segment's exposure and management of currency risk.
